What is REX Concrete?

REX Concrete
ConstructionConstruction Management

Based in Cedar Rapids, REX Concrete has established itself as a premier provider of specialized concrete services, including industrial flooring, parking lot construction, and curb and gutter installation. With over three decades of technical expertise, the company serves a diverse clientele ranging from local community institutions to large-scale industrial logistics parks. By adhering to rigorous FF/FL specifications, REX Concrete maintains a high standard of quality that differentiates its service offerings in the regional market. The company's ability to execute complex projects, such as the Logistics Park Cedar Rapids Warehouse, highlights its operational maturity and capacity to handle large-scale infrastructure demands.
